How fast do you respond to a Sherwood Park support request?
Requests are acknowledged within minutes during business hours and we target same-business-day resolution for the majority of issues. Remote-first means a technician is already working the problem rather than scheduling a drive across Strathcona County.
Do you provide on-site support across the Heartland industrial area?
Yes. Remote resolves most issues fastest, and we arrange on-site dispatch for hardware, networking, and anything that genuinely requires physical presence across Sherwood Park, the Heartland, and Fort Saskatchewan.
Can you support a co-managed arrangement with our internal IT person?
Absolutely. Many Sherwood Park businesses have an internal resource who needs helpdesk overflow, monitoring tooling, and after-hours coverage. We handle that layer so your person focuses on higher-value work rather than every incoming ticket.
Do you manage new employee onboarding for energy-sector or industrial businesses?
We do. Device imaging, account provisioning, and Microsoft 365 setup are handled so new hires are productive on day one. Offboarding follows an equally thorough checklist so access is revoked cleanly when someone leaves.

How do you handle onboarding and offboarding for a high-turnover sector like energy services?
We use standardised imaging and provisioning workflows so device setup and account creation are fast and consistent regardless of volume. New Sherwood Park hires receive the right access levels from day one without waiting on manual processes. Offboarding is equally systematic: every account and system access is revoked cleanly, which matters when staff transitions are frequent.
What if the same IT issue keeps recurring at our Sherwood Park location?
We document every resolution and investigate root causes rather than patching the same symptom repeatedly. That documentation accumulates into a reliable picture of your Sherwood Park environment, which means persistent issues get resolved at the source and support quality improves as the relationship matures rather than staying flat.
